5. Cookies, Tracking, and Website Techniques

We typically use "cookies" and similar techniques on our website(s), which allow for the identification of your browser or device.

  • Session vs. Permanent Cookies: We use "session cookies" (deleted after your visit) and "permanent cookies" (saved for a period, e.g., two years) to save configurations like language or automated log-in.
  • Wix Platform: As our website is hosted on the Wix platform, specific Necessary Cookies are used to ensure system stability, security (monitoring for cyber-attacks), and payment security. These cannot be opted out of.
  • Google Analytics: We use Google Analytics (Google Ireland Ltd.). We have configured the service so that IP addresses are truncated in Europe before forwarding to the US. We have turned off the «Data sharing» and “Signals” options.
  • Social Media Plug-ins: We use plug-ins from networks like Facebook, Twitter, YouTube, Pinterest, or Instagram. These are disabled by default. Clicking them allows operators to record your presence on our site.
  • Tracking Pixels: Our newsletters may include tracking pixels (invisible image files). If retrieved from our servers, we can determine if and when you opened the email. You may disable this in your email program settings.
  • Control: You may configure your browser to reject cookies. However, blocking them may make certain functions (e.g., shopping basket, ordering) unavailable.

7. Duration of the Retention of Personal Data

We process and retain your data only for as long as it is necessary for the fulfillment of our contractual and legal obligations:

  • Accounting & Tax Records: Invoices and payment data are retained for 10 years in accordance with the Swiss Code of Obligations (Art. 958f).
  • Coaching & Consulting Records: Session notes, CVs, and professional data are generally retained for the duration of the relationship and for 5 to 10 years thereafter, in accordance with the Swiss Statute of Limitations (Art. 127 OR), to protect against legal claims or support returning clients.
  • Technical Logs: Operational data (e.g., system records) are generally deleted within twelve months or less.
